Hamerton is sending a sample of armadillo skin. There is no pachyderm skin available "but a big-time bomb is lying near the den of the £2000 [sic] Indian Rhinoceros! We expect the bomb to explode at any minute and bump off the Rhino - We will send along any scraps of skin that may be left after the explosion - if it occurs." If the bomb does not explode there will be a long wait for a pachyderm to die naturally. If the need is urgent Hamerton suggests SZ try Gerrards.
SZ's reply on verso.
